Как пройти обучение в «Учебном центре»
Нужна помощь с выбором курса? Напишите нам, поможем!
✅ Расскажем, какие документы нужны
✅ Поможем выбрать курс
✅ Подберем практику при необходимости
Действуем по закону
Лицензия № Л035-01298-77/00180557 официально зарегистрирована в реестре Рособрнадзора
Вы можете проверить подлинность всех документов на сайте Рособрнадзора
Наша деятельность строго соответствует требованиям контролирующих органов
Образовательные программы включены в государственный реестр и актуальны на 2026 год
Гарантируем прозрачность: без скрытых платежей, с полной и своевременной отчетностью
Каждому клиенту предоставляется полный пакет документов: договор, счет, акт, документы по завершению обучения, а также карточка организации для проверки СБ
Более 3 000 специалистов и свыше 250 компаний доверили нам сопровождение и успешно прошли все проверки
Ознакомьтесь с мнениями наших клиентов — отзывы доступны на сайте
Способы оплаты в «Учебном центре»
Выдаем официальные документы (переподготовка)
По окончании обучения, выдаются документы, с внесением в государственный реестр об образовании.
Срок выдачи от 1 дня
В документах не указывается форма обучения
- Диплом о профессиональной переподготовки
- Приложения к диплому
- Внесение данных в государственный реестр ФРДО
Кто такой архитектор программной системы
Архитектор программной системы — это высококвалифицированный специалист в сфере информационных технологий, который занимается проектированием и разработкой комплексных программных решений. Его главная задача — создание архитектуры программного продукта, обеспечивающей эффективное взаимодействие всех компонентов системы, ее масштабируемость, надежность и безопасность. Работа архитектора заключается не только в техническом планировании, но и в понимании бизнес-задач, которые должен решать программный продукт. Он выступает связующим звеном между заказчиком, разработчиками и тестировщиками, помогая превратить требования в готовое программное решение.Роль архитектора программной системы в современном IT-проекте
Архитектор программной системы играет ключевую роль на всех этапах жизненного цикла программного обеспечения:- Анализ требований: изучение и формализация потребностей пользователя.
- Проектирование: разработка каркаса решения, выбор технологий и инструментов.
- Контроль реализации: поддержка разработки, помощь программистам в решении сложных задач.
- Тестирование и оптимизация: проверка систем на соответствие требованиям и обеспечение высокой производительности.
- Поддержка и развитие: обновление архитектуры и интеграция новых компонентов.
Основные направления и содержание программы обучения «Архитектор программной системы»
Современные образовательные программы для архитектора программных систем охватывают широкий спектр тем и навыков. В зависимости от выбранной глубины и продолжительности обучения, структура программ может значительно отличаться. Рассмотрим основные форматы обучения и их содержание.Варианты программы обучения
Обучение по направлению «Архитектор программной системы» делится на несколько категорий в соответствии с объемом академических часов:| Вариант программы | Объем обучения (ак. часов) | Основной акцент в программе |
|---|---|---|
| Базовый курс | 250-500 | Основы проектирования и архитектуры, базовые методологии разработки |
| Средний курс | 500-1000 | Углубленные архитектурные паттерны, интеграция технологий, работа с современными фреймворками |
| Продвинутый курс | 1000-1600 | Комплексные архитектурные решения, распределенные системы, безопасность и масштабируемость |
| Профессиональная программа | От 1600 | Глубокое погружение в технологии, управление архитектурой в крупных проектах, стратегическое планирование |
Типичные модули обучения
Независимо от продолжительности, программа обучения включает в себя следующие основные блоки:- Основы архитектуры программных систем: концепции, принципы и цели проектирования.
- Методологии разработки ПО: Agile, Scrum, DevOps и другие техники организации процесса.
- Архитектурные паттерны: слоистая архитектура, микросервисы, клиент-сервер, event-driven и др.
- Технологии и инструменты: языки программирования, фреймворки, средства визуализации, системы контроля версий.
- Интеграция и взаимодействие компонентов: API, протоколы, сервис-ориентированная архитектура.
- Безопасность и надежность: обеспечение защиты данных и устойчивость системы к отказам.
- Документирование архитектуры: создание и поддержка проектной документации.
- Коммуникация и управление проектами: взаимодействие с командами, участие в планировании.
Навыки и знания, которые получает слушатель в ходе обучения
Обучающая программа направлена на формирование комплексного набора компетенций, необходимых для успешной работы архитектором программных систем.Технические навыки
В процессе обучения слушатель осваивает ключевые технические умения, включая:- Проектирование архитектуры программного обеспечения с учетом функциональных и нефункциональных требований.
- Понимание принципов построения распределенных и масштабируемых систем.
- Знание и применение архитектурных стилей и паттернов.
- Работа с современными языками программирования и фреймворками.
- Организация взаимодействия различных компонентов и сервисов.
- Обеспечение безопасности и устойчивости программных продуктов.
- Автоматизация процессов разработки и тестирования.
Организационные и коммуникативные навыки
Архитектор программной системы должен уметь не только создавать технические решения, но и эффективно работать в команде и с заказчиками. В программу входят:- Методы управления проектами в IT-среде.
- Работа с требованиями и их трансформация в архитектурные решения.
- Разработка и презентация технической документации.
- Навыки переговоров и разрешения конфликтных ситуаций.
- Организация взаимодействия междисциплинарных команд.
- Понимание бизнес-процессов и стратегическое мышление.
Применение полученных знаний на практике
Важной частью обучения является работа над реальными или приближенными к реальным проектами. Это помогает закрепить теоретические знания, развить аналитическое мышление и выработать навыки принятия решений в нестандартных ситуациях.Как проходит процесс обучения архитектора программной системы
Рабочая программа строится так, чтобы максимально охватить все основные темы и дать возможность студентам самостоятельно овладеть нужными компетенциями.Форматы обучения
Обучение может проходить в различных форматах, включая:- Очные лекции и семинары с практическими заданиями.
- Дистанционные курсы с видеоуроками и интерактивными материалами.
- Смешанное обучение, совмещающее самостоятельное изучение и онлайн-консультации.
- Групповые проекты, направленные на отработку командных взаимодействий.
Методы и формы контроля знаний
Для оценки усвоения материала применяются разные инструменты, например:| Метод контроля | Цель | Форма проведения |
|---|---|---|
| Тестирование | Проверка теоретических знаний | Онлайн-тесты, письменные экзамены |
| Практические задания | Развитие навыков проектирования архитектуры | Курсовые работы, проектные задачи |
| Групповые проекты | Умение работать в команде и решать комплексные задачи | Совместная разработка архитектурных решений |
| Защита проектов | Оценка способности аргументировать и презентовать свои решения | Публичные доклады, обсуждения с преподавателями и экспертами |
Роль наставников и экспертов
В процессе обучения важна поддержка опытных специалистов, которые помогают ориентироваться в сложных темах, дают рекомендации по развитию и карьере, а также способствуют обмену опытом между участниками.Перспективы и возможности после завершения обучения
Получение квалификации архитектора программных систем открывает широкий спектр профессиональных возможностей.Карьера и профессиональный рост
Выпускник программы сможет занять позиции, связанные с проектированием и ведением крупных IT-проектов, работать в командах разработки программного обеспечения различной направленности, а также реализовывать собственные уникальные решения. Среди возможных ролей:- Архитектор программных систем.
- Технический руководитель проекта.
- Консультант по архитектуре и интеграции систем.
- Исследователь и разработчик новых архитектурных паттернов.
Дополнительные возможности
Обучение позволяет развивать навыки, применимые и в смежных областях:- Управление IT-инфраструктурой и проектами.
- Разработка стандартов и регламентов для программных продуктов.
- Консультирование по вопросам цифровой трансформации бизнеса.
Непрерывное профессиональное развитие
IT-сфера постоянно развивается, и чтобы оставаться востребованным специалистом, необходимо постоянно обновлять знания и навыки. Программы обучения часто включают рекомендации для дальнейшего самостоятельного изучения и повышения квалификации, что способствует постоянному развитию профессии.Заключение
Профессия архитектора программной системы — одна из самых востребованных и перспективных в современной IT-индустрии. Обучение данной специальности предполагает освоение широкого круга компетенций — от глубоких технических знаний до умений эффективно взаимодействовать с командой и заказчиками. Выбор варианта программы обучения зависит от поставленных целей, имеющегося опыта и времени, которое слушатель готов уделить изучению. Это может быть как базовый курс для получения первоначальных знаний, так и масштабная профессиональная программа, открывающая двери к руководящим позициям в сложных IT-проектах. Архитектор программных систем — это специалист, способный создавать технологические решения будущего и вносить значительный вклад в развитие цифровой экономики. Именно поэтому качественное обучение и постоянное развитие в этой области востребованы на рынке труда и открывают широкие возможности для карьерного роста.Нужна помощь с выбором курса? Напишите нам, поможем!
✅ Расскажем, какие документы нужны
✅ Поможем выбрать курс
✅ Подберем практику при необходимости
Преимущества обучения
Фотогалерея
Преподаватели
Вопрос-ответ
Если у вас возникнут вопросы или спорные ситуации — вы всегда можете обратиться к руководству для их урегулирования, вплоть до возврата средств.
Обучение требуется, если:
-
на работе изменились функции или оборудование;
-
вы перешли в другую профессиональную сферу;
-
необходимо официальное подтверждение новых обязанностей.
Также вы можете пройти переквалификацию добровольно, чтобы сменить профессию или расширить свою квалификацию.